**Escalation — PortionPal scaler**

If the scaling math goes sideways (fractions of eggs, negative flour, you know the drill), first check the unit-conversion cache in the Brindleworth cluster. Restart the converter pod once; if results are still wrong after five minutes, page the Kitchen Math rotation. Don't sit on it — bad ratios hit real users' dinners. For anything weirder, reach the PortionPal leads here.

escalation mailbox, yajeg-bageg: quenax.olidor@lumiccorp.internal

**Q: Where do contractors sign in while Harwick House is under renovation?**

Use the temporary site at Delmont Yard, Unit 4. The main entrance is closed; enter via the loading ramp on the east side. Sign-in sheets are at the portacabin by the gate. High-vis and boots required past the hoarding. Site hours are 07:00–17:30, weekdays only. The gate keypad accepts the code below.

staff pass of kawip-hawef = bdg-QLP-2

**Test plan: contrast audit, Dimlight release**

Scope: all customer-facing views in Palettecheck's web console. Target WCAG AA ratios; flag anything under 4.5:1 for body text, 3:1 for large text. Run automated sweep first, then manual spot checks on the dark theme — it's the usual offender. Log failures with screenshots and computed ratios. The audit runner posts results to the reporting endpoint; authenticate it with the token below.

session JWT of yawep-yawep = eyJhbGciOiJIUzI1NiIsInR5cCI6IkpXVCJ9.eyJzdWIiOiI3pWF3_In0.aXYsHiog

Welcome to Pinwheel support! Heads up on a known bug: session tokens sometimes fail to refresh after midnight UTC, logging users out of the Marlowe dashboard. Workaround: have them clear cookies and re-auth. If that fails, escalate to tier two via the recovery console, which you open with the passphrase just below.

unlock words, fafop-hawep: briwyn-oliix-sorox

Runbook 4.2 — inbound samples from Tellvane Research. Receiving site checks: cooler seal intact, temp strip green, manifest count matches. Reject on any broken seal; call the duty lead, do not open. Storage: cold room B within ten minutes of sign-in. Courier waits until checks clear. Apply the hand-over instruction stated below:

handover note for yagef-bagep: the drudor pelius courier leaves the kasdor zorvan norir ledger at gate 8016 under passcode 755406